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T)
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) is a structured therapeutic approach designed for couples, highlighting the interrelationship between thoughts, emotions, and behaviors, which can mitigate financial conflicts. thoughts, emotions, and behaviors. This method assists partners in effectively addressing communication issues. By identifying and challenging negative thought patterns, couples can develop problem-solving skills that enable them to navigate relational challenges constructively.
Within this therapeutic framework, the therapist typically guides partners in identifying specific thoughts that contribute to misunderstandings or conflicts. For example, one partner may interpret a delayed response to a text message as a sign of disinterest, which can lead to feelings of resentment and emotional distance. By reframing this interpretation to recognize that there may be various reasons for the delay, such as work obligations or personal commitments, couples can foster healthier communication.
The benefits of CBT include improved emotional intimacy, as partners begin to feel validated in their feelings. Additionally, conflict resolution techniques that emphasize collaboration rather than criticism become more effective.
In situations such as financial disagreements or differing parenting styles, the application of CBT can promote open dialogues in which each partner feels heard and understood. Consequently, they can collaboratively work towards solutions, preventing the escalation of conflict.

Resolving Conflicts and Issues
Another significant benefit of couples therapy, including Emotion-Focused Therapy and Imago Relationship Therapy, lies in its emphasis on addressing conflicts and issues that may jeopardize the relationship. Therapists provide couples with conflict resolution strategies that facilitate constructive navigation of disagreements, thereby minimizing emotional distance and fostering a deeper connection.
By employing various techniques such as active listening, reframing, and compromise, therapists assist individuals in gaining insight into each other’s perspectives. For example, a couple experiencing communication difficulties may utilize these tools to articulate their needs more effectively while also attentively considering their partner’s concerns. Common relationship challenges, including jealousy, financial strain, and differing parenting styles, can be effectively addressed through these methods.
- Jealousy: Therapists promote open discussions to reveal underlying fears and insecurities.
- Financial Stress: Strategies may encompass joint budgeting and discussions regarding values.
- Differing Parenting Styles: Techniques focus on establishing common ground and shared objectives.
Ultimately, the effective resolution of conflicts can lead to a more fulfilling relationship characterized by trust and mutual respect.

When Is Couples Counseling Not Effective?
Couples therapy may not yield positive outcomes in certain circumstances, particularly when one or both partners are unwilling to engage in the therapeutic process or when significant relationship issues, such as emotional distance or trust concerns, remain unaddressed. In situations involving severe psychological distress or abuse, alternative interventions may be necessary.
If one partner is facing unresolved personal issues, such as mental health challenges or past traumas, this may impede their ability to fully participate in therapy. A lack of commitment from either party can hinder even the most skilled therapist’s efforts to facilitate meaningful progress.
Moreover,
- Severe emotional withdrawal can obstruct open communication, making it difficult to rebuild intimacy.
- If trust issues persist, couples may struggle to be vulnerable with one another, resulting in further disconnection.
These factors highlight the importance of couples assessing their readiness for therapy. In certain cases, seeking individual therapy or support groups may prove to be more advantageous. Recognizing when traditional couples therapy may not be sufficient is essential in the journey toward healing, as it ensures that partners effectively address both their relationship dynamics and individual challenges.
